Choosing the right portable Bluetooth speaker involves understanding several key factors. Beyond just sound quality, considerations such as waterproofing, battery life, portability, and extra features like lights or power banks can dramatically impact your experience. Knowing how to weigh these aspects helps prevent common pitfalls—like buying a speaker that’s too fragile or lacking enough battery for your outings. Here are the main factors to consider when selecting a speaker suited to your needs.Sound Quality and Power
Sound performance is often the primary reason for choosing a speaker. Look for wattage ratings and speaker configurations that match your intended use—more power generally means louder and fuller sound. However, higher wattage isn’t always necessary for personal use; smaller speakers can still deliver impressive audio for small groups. Consider if clarity, bass response, and volume are balanced for your environment, whether it’s outdoor gatherings or indoor listening.
Durability and Waterproofing
Durability matters when taking your speaker outdoors. Waterproof ratings like IPX7 or IPX5 indicate resistance to water and dust, making some models suitable for beach trips or rain. Drop-proof features add extra protection against accidents, which is essential for active lifestyles. Be cautious of overly fragile designs if you plan to carry the speaker frequently or expose it to rough conditions.
Battery Life and Charging
Long battery life extends your listening without frequent recharges. In most cases, a 12-24 hour runtime covers a full day of use, but some models offer even more. Keep in mind that battery longevity can decline over time, so consider how often you’ll need to recharge and whether quick-charging features are available. A larger battery often means a bigger or heavier speaker, so balance size against runtime based on portability needs.
Size and Portability
Size influences how easily you can carry a speaker everywhere. Compact models fit easily into bags or pockets but may lack bass or volume compared to larger units. Conversely, bigger speakers like the JBL PartyBox 110 deliver more power and features but are less convenient to lug around. Think about where you’ll use the speaker most often—on the go, at home, or during outdoor adventures—and choose accordingly.
Additional Features
Extras such as LED lights, TWS pairing for stereo sound, power banks, or voice assistant support can enhance your experience. However, these features often come at a price or add to the size and complexity of the device. Focus on what genuinely improves your usage—if you enjoy parties, lights and powerful sound may be priorities; for outdoor hikes, ruggedness and battery life might matter more.
Frequently Asked Questions
How do I know if a Bluetooth speaker is loud enough for outdoor use?
To gauge outdoor loudness, look for wattage ratings (usually 20W or higher) and reviews mentioning volume levels in open spaces. Larger speakers like the JBL PartyBox 110 or JBL Charge 6 tend to produce higher volumes suitable for outdoor gatherings. Keep in mind that environmental noise and open areas require more power, so a speaker with at least 20W and good bass response generally performs better outside.
Is waterproofing enough to protect my speaker during outdoor activities?
Waterproofing is a vital feature for outdoor use, but it should be complemented by a rugged, drop-proof design for full protection. An IPX7 rating means the speaker can be submerged in water, making it safe for beach or poolside use; IPX5 models resist splashes but aren’t suitable for full immersion. Combining waterproofing with shock resistance ensures your speaker survives accidental drops or rough handling during outdoor adventures.
Should I prioritize battery life over sound quality?
Balancing battery life and sound quality depends on your primary use. If you need all-day listening or outdoor excursions, longer battery life—20-30 hours—should be a priority. However, some models deliver surprisingly good sound with shorter runtimes. For critical listening or parties where audio clarity and volume matter most, a slightly shorter battery life might be acceptable if the sound performance is superior.
Are larger speakers more portable than smaller ones?
Generally, larger speakers like the JBL PartyBox 110 or JBL Charge 6 offer more power and features but are less portable due to their size and weight. Smaller models such as the JBL Go 4 or Bose SoundLink Flex are designed for easy transport and fit into bags or pockets. The best choice depends on your mobility needs—if portability is a priority, pick a compact, lightweight option; for louder sound outdoors, a larger, more powerful speaker is better.
What should I consider if I want a speaker for outdoor use and parties?
For outdoor use and parties, durability, high volume, and battery life are key. Look for waterproof ratings like IPX7 or IPX5, along with rugged designs that resist drops and dust. Bright LED lights or TWS pairing for stereo sound can enhance the party atmosphere. Keep in mind that larger, more powerful models tend to be less portable but provide the volume and durability needed for lively outdoor environments.
